Want to help Apollo Elementary’s 400-plus students become more fit and healthy? All it takes is a few clicks of your computer mouse.

Apollo is one of a number of schools across the nation in competition for a grant from Big Lots, the closeout retailer. Each school asking for a grant created a short video, and all videos are now posted on a Big Lots website.

Schools will be chosen to receive grants according to how many times visitors to the site vote for a specific school and their video. Voting lasts through July 22.

If Apollo wins a grant, the funds will be used to construct a walking track at the school.
